And so the planning begins...

That's planning for 2015 of course, not your Christmas lunch... What will your focus be next year? David Alves suggests eight things to consider when plotting your 2015 digital marketing strategy.

Elsa Gouws reckons the global war for talent is intensifying, making it increasingly difficult for businesses without strong employer brands to be competitive; and Leigh Andrews, covering the DMX Conference, shares Andrew Glenister of GraphicMail's examples of how to optimise email newsletters - specifically for mobile.

Keeping on the topic of mobile, according to John-William Awbrey, as the growth in mobile communications brings about a revolution in market research, it is the vast continent of Africa that is leading the way. He says that though some may be reticent to adopt mobile solutions, the advantages are too big for African researchers to ignore.

In other news, Airtel has launched its 'Catapult-a-Startup' initiative, and Opera Mediaworks has acquired South African premium mobile-advertising network, AdVine.
